About the Role

This is a highly collaborative, field-based leadership role that serves as the operational bridge between hygiene teams and field leadership. The Director of Hygiene Operations will help ensure the consistent execution of established clinical standards, workflows, and best practices across the organization. The role also provides clinical hygiene coverage from time to time to maintain proficiency and stay connected to patient care.

Responsibilities

  • Serve as the primary liaison and resource for hygienists across multiple states.
  • Partner closely with the Clinical Support Team, Regional Vice Presidents, and Operations leadership to support and implement hygiene initiatives and organizational priorities.
  • Maintain regular communication with hygiene teams, providing guidance, answering questions, and ensuring timely follow-up.
  • Visit practices regularly to observe workflows, reinforce established best practices, and provide hands-on support.
  • Monitor consistency of hygiene protocols, clinical workflows, standard operating procedures, and organizational expectations across all locations.
  • Support the onboarding and integration of hygienists into organizational standards and workflows.
  • Participate in clinical observations, office visits, and hygiene audits while partnering with local leadership to identify opportunities for improvement and ensure follow-through.
  • Coordinate communication between hygiene teams and corporate support departments to ensure alignment and consistency.
  • Track organizational initiatives and action items to ensure projects are implemented effectively and completed on time.
  • Assist in the development and distribution of educational resources, reference materials, and communications that support hygiene teams.
  • Provide clinical hygiene coverage on an as-needed basis to support practices, maintain clinical proficiency, and remain connected to patient care and office operations.
  • Ensure compliance with company policies, regulatory requirements, infection control standards, and clinical best practices.

Requirements

  • Licensed Registered Dental Hygienist (RDH) in good standing with the ability and willingness to provide clinical hygiene services on an as-needed basis.
  • 7–10+ years of progressive dental hygiene experience, including experience supporting multiple locations or leading teams within a multi-site dental organization.
  • Strong understanding of clinical hygiene workflows, preventive dentistry, infection control, and operational best practices.
  • Excellent organizational, communication, and follow-up skills.
  • Proven ability to build strong relationships with clinicians, office leadership, and executive teams.
  • Self-motivated, collaborative, and comfortable managing mult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
  • Willingness to travel extensively throughout the organization's network of practices.
